How To Maintain an Office Building

If you own a large office building, you know that maintaining the property is important to keep your tenants happy and make their employees feel safe while working. Implementing safety measures to keep everyone happy doesn’t have to be difficult. Use these three tips to make sure your office building stays safe for the people who work in it.

Make Necessary Repairs Quickly

Various parts of your building will need maintenance as it ages. From repairing cracked sheetrock to replacing old doorframes and windows, you should expect to spend money each year on maintenance. The faster you repair problematic areas of the building, the less likely it is the repairs will be extensive and expensive. Keep the Building Clean

Cleanliness is important for helping people stay healthy. While you can expect the people who work in each office of your building to do their part to keep the space relatively clean, it is still a good idea to hire a cleaning crew to deep clean and sanitize the building once a week. This helps keep the building in good condition and improves the health of the people who work inside it.

Hire a Security Team

You value your property so it is a good idea to hire a security team to protect it. You don’t have to spend a ton of money on a security team, but installing a few cameras and hiring a couple of security guards goes a long way in preventing vandalism and helping your tenants feel safe.

If you make your office building a space that is conducive for productivity, tenants are more likely to renew their leases, which improves your bottom line. Use these three habits to keep your tenants happy.
